We are seeking a highly organized and detail orientated Manufacturing Scheduler. The Manufacturing Scheduler will be responsible for planning all aspects of manufacturing production activity including personnel schedule, balancing resource demands, and scheduling production support work and training. The position serves as a driving force in production and will use planning and data analysis tools to implement an efficient personnel schedule optimized to support production with a matrixed workforce. The ideal candidate will have extensive experience with production planning and a solid understanding of biologics manufacturing processes and their operational units. Strong time management, analytical, interpersonal, and communications skills are a must.
Responsibilities:
Responsible for scheduling and/planning activities required to support the manufacturing and timely release of clinical and commercial materials. Assure communication with Site planning-department and schedule required resources to execute.Participate in cross-functional meetings to communicate schedule status, potential risks, and mitigation plans.Attend/facilitate the daily Tier meetings and Weekly Scheduling Team (WST) meetings to coordinate schedules, identify and resolve resource conflicts.Review production orders to determine personnel and operational schedules and commit to manufacturing slots/dates.Determine progress of work and completion dates and work with the manufacturing team supervisors to set daily production priorities.Coordinate reporting and help to resolve production or material issues by working directly with manufacturing and Supply Chain leadership to identify disruptions, delays, bottlenecks, and reprioritize as needed.Monitor and report on KPI’s related to production scheduling such as schedule adherence, on-time delivery, cycle times and resource utilization.Translate the high-level lot production schedule to a detailed manufacturing schedule with names and times assigned to the separate tasks.Communicate with F&E department on scheduled and unscheduled maintenance activities and ensure there is no conflict with the manufacturing production schedule or resource conflicts.Work with operations team to determine labor and equipment capacity.Be part of and interact with project teams to assess the impact of project activities on the personnel and operational schedules.Coordinate with Tech Training department to schedule training plans/activities in alignment with manufacturing personnel training needs and training team objectives.Provide training and support to back-up and future junior schedulers.Lead continuous improvement initiatives to enhance scheduling processes, reduce lead times, and increase production flexibility.Collaborates cross-functionally with Quality, Facilities/Engineering/Maintenance, MSAT, Supply Chain/Materials Management/Warehouse, and Training.Develop and implement planning tools through relevant software such as MS Project, MS Office, scheduling software (e.g., Shiftboard, Deputy, SAP Workforce Management), or Advanced Planning and Scheduling software (SAP IBP/APS).Optimize resource utilization (facility/suite, equipment, staff, materials) for efficient operations within manufacturing and with other departments such as QA/QC.Support new product introductions by coordinating the manufacturing personnel schedule with leadership and key stakeholders such as F&E, QC, QA, and MSAT.Other duties as assigned.Basic Qualifications:

Kite is a biopharmaceutical company engaged in the development of innovative cancer immunotherapies with a goal of providing rapid, long-term durable response and eliminating the burden of chronic care. The company is focused on chimeric antigen receptor (CAR) and T cell receptor (TCR) engineered cell therapies designed to empower the immune system's ability to recognize and kill tumors.
